Q What is the constitution of the endocrine system?
The endocrine system is constituted by the hormones and the endocrine glands they secrete.
Q. What is the histological nature of the glands? How are they formed?
The glands are epithelial tissues and they are prepared of epithelium that during the embryonic development invaginated into other tissues.
In the endocrine glands the invagination is complete and there are no secretion ducts, in the exocrine glands the invagination has preserved secretion ducts.
